Cognex Posts 2nd Best Quarter

Natick machine sensor maker Cognex Corp. reported quarterly increases of 1 percent in revenue and 4 percent in net income for the second quarter of the year.
Revenue rose to $84.3 million from $83.4 million in the same quarter of last year, while profits increased to $19.8 million from $19.1 million.

Cognex’s chairman, Robert J. Shillman, called the results “fantastic” as the company had its second-best revenue-generating quarter in its 31-year history. But Shillman warned that because of a “very challenging economic environment, we don’t expect to break these records in the near term.”

CEO Robert J. Willett issued a “cautious” outlook for the third quarter for several reasons, such as a pullback on spending by manufacturers amid a global economic slowdown, and continued “uncertainty in currency exchange rates.”
